Abstract

An internal combustion engine has an intake tract, at least one cylinder, an exhaust gas tract and inlet and outlet valves, which are assigned to the cylinder. An exhaust gas pressure in the cylinder is determined during the valve overlap of the inlet and outlet valves as a function of an estimated value of an exhaust gas pressure, which is effected by the combustion of an air/fuel mixture in the cylinder, and a variable which characterizes the centroid of the valve overlap of the inlet and outlet valves. At least one actuating signal for controlling an actuator of the internal combustion engine is derived from the exhaust gas pressure, or the internal combustion engine is monitored as a function of the exhaust gas pressure.
